#3680e6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3680e6 is composed of 21.2% red, 50.2% green and 90.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.5% cyan, 44.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 214.8 degrees, a saturation of 77.9% and a lightness of 55.7%. #3680e6 color hex could be obtained by blending #6cffff with #0001cd.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

#3680e6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3680e6 has RGB values of R:54, G:128, B:230 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0.44,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 3571942.

Shades and Tints of #3680e6
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010408 is the darkest color, while #f6f9f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3680e6
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d8e8f is the less saturated color, while #257df7 is the most saturated one.
